G-FIX Correction Outage Technology
G-FIX Correction Outage Technology refers to the use of methods and techniques to mitigate the effects of GNSS correction data loss or outage,which is used to improve the accuracy of positioning by correcting errors caused by atmospheric and other environmental factors.

Brand-New Calibration and initialization FREE IMU
By utilizing a highly accurate Inertial Measurement Unit (IMU) and a unique tilt compensation function, RTK tilt measurement has been made practical.
No calibration required, GINTEC G40 RTK is ready for precise measurement from the moment when it is turned on, allowing instant use.
It is resistant to magnetic interference, making it suitable for use in any location.
RTK measurement is no longer bound by bubbles, realizing an efficiency improvement of at least 30%, and greater measurement accuracy is guaranteed.
AR Stakeout
Use an AR tool to visualize the location and position of a design feature or structure on a real-world site.This involves using a GNSS receiver to locate the position of the design feature or structure on the site, and then overlaying an augmented reality image of the feature onto the real-world view.This process helps the surveyors to accurately stake out the location of the feature or structure and ensure that it is built according to the design specifications.
